Luxurious Accommodations
Grand Nar Hotel Adults Only offers air-conditioned rooms with satellite TV, private bathrooms, minibar, and balconies. The perfect retreat after a day of exploring.
Indulgent Dining Options
Start your day with a delicious buffet breakfast and enjoy traditional and world cuisine at the buffet restaurant. Need a quick bite? Head to the snack bar or pool bar for a tasty treat.
Relaxation and Entertainment
Unwind at the spa with a Turkish bath, sauna, and massage services. Join the entertainment staff's shows or dance the night away at the on-site nightclub. And for the little ones, there's a children's playground to keep them entertained.

The current 4-star rating associated with the Grand Nar Hotel is a profound misrepresentation of the property, and whoever evaluated it at that standard severely misjudged it. I urge all booking platforms, including Love Holidays, Expedia, and Booking.com, to follow TripAdvisor’s lead in removing this hotel from their listings effective Sunday, August 23rd. This establishment poses a severe safety risk, operates unprofessionally, and requires an immediate formal investigation.
During my stay in ground-floor Room 1029, I discovered the balcony door was entirely broken and incapable of locking. Upon reporting this critical security breach to the manager on three separate occasions, my concerns were continuously deflected as he repeatedly changed the subject. In a staggering display of unprofessionalism, the maintenance worker who came to look at it took it upon himself to place his foot in the door track to create the physical illusion of a functioning lock, blatantly attempting to deceive me. Adding insult to injury, I later observed this same maintenance worker operating on scaffolding to repair a minor cosmetic crack in the ceiling, prioritizing superficial aesthetics over a guest's fundamental physical safety.
From the moment I entered the establishment, my hypervigilance kicked in immediately. The staff's overall conduct was highly inappropriate and invasive. I was subjected to suspicious, probing questions regarding my personal income and whether I had family waiting for me back home, while the manager actively scanned me for valuables, taking clear notice of my watch. Given the compromised security of my ground-floor room, these inquiries and behaviors felt entirely predatory. I was left with the distinct, unsettling impression that I was being targeted for a potential robbery before the end of my trip.
This lack of security severely restricted my holiday. Unable to safely leave my valuables in my room, I was forced to carry my passport, phone, and wallet on a boat excursion. Consequently, I was unable to participate in any water activities, as my passport was in my pocket and is not waterproof, which entirely ruined the experience.
Furthermore, the hotel's spa service appears to engage in fraudulent practices. After I disclosed a genuine back issue, the spa staff pressured me into paying 2,500 Lira upfront for a specialized "medical massage." The appointment was never fulfilled. When I confronted management the following morning, the staff feigned total ignorance. The manager—who was noticeably hungover—also played dumb, leaving me to suspect my money was misappropriated to fund his evening out. Meanwhile, the hotel’s overarching boss was completely unapproachable, as he was entirely preoccupied with surveilling the Russian guests at breakfast like a prison warden rather than addressing a clear theft on his premises.
The psychological toll of staying here was immense. The refrigerator adjacent to my broken balcony door frequently made a clicking noise identical to a sliding door opening. To ensure my physical safety, I was forced to barricade the broken door with the heavy refrigerator and balance an ashtray on the bottom rails to serve as a makeshift alarm system in the event of an intrusion. Consequently, I endured two days on a mere three hours of sleep, trapped in a state of high anxiety.
While the pool and room cleanliness were adequate, the catering consisted of repetitive, generic meals every single day. Ultimately, the situation became so untenable that I utilized the Love Holidays support chat to arrange a discreet, emergency transfer. I paid £550 out of pocket to relocate to the Naturella Apart Hotel—a 3-star property that felt like a 10-star luxury resort by comparison. Due to the overt hostility of the Grand Nar's manager, I felt compelled to sneak off the premises without notifying the staff.
The Grand Nar Hotel is an unsafe establishment managed by individuals who engage in exploitative and deceptive practices. Room 1029, alongside the entire operation, demands a comprehensive investigation. I strongly advise all travelers to avoid this property under any circumstances.
